The following is a statement from Ned McGrath, director of communications for the Archdiocese of Detroit:
"The Detroit archdiocese has been unable to speak with Fr. Demmer to confirm that the documents distributed on Thursday, 27th September, came from him - correspondence to Cardinal Maida and separate correspondence to the parishioners of St. Dunstan. Regardless of the source, it's hard to understand how these materials will help a parish community that is sorely in need of healing at this particular time.
"Fr. Demmer's resignation as pastor was accepted and that decision stands. While this was a difficult matter for everyone involved, the change was made for the good and well-being of Fr. Demmer himself and for the parish.
"In regard to the criminal investigation of suspected financial wrongdoing at St. Dunstan, the archdiocese is cooperating fully with the Garden City Police Department."
